Pionts dont matter to the insurance companies anymore. They see whatever the court agrees on and modifies your coverage accordingly. Say you get it reduced to 5 or 10 over, which is no points, the insurance company still sees it and adds it to your policy.

Try and lessen the fine or get the ticket dropped. When did you get this ticket, was it snowing? Was there a tree in the way of the sign? Is there a street light above the sign?
